Summary
Involved in protein targeting to vacuole; vacuolar acidification; and vacuole inheritance. Located in endosome. Part of CORVET complex. Orthologous to human TGFBRAP1 (transforming growth factor beta receptor associated protein 1). [provided by Alliance of Genome Resources, Apr 2022]

General protein information

Preferred Names
CORVET complex subunit VPS3
NP_010783.3
  • Component of CORVET membrane tethering complex; cytoplasmic protein required for the sorting and processing of soluble vacuolar proteins, acidification of the vacuolar lumen, and assembly of the vacuolar H+-ATPase
